Paper: GS – II, Subject: Polity, Topic: Judiciary, Issue: Supreme Court Orders Removal of Stray Dogs.
Context:
The Supreme Court ordered stray dogs to be removed from key public areas in line with the ABC Rules, 2023, which require humane sterilisation and vaccination.
Key Takeaways:
What the Supreme Court Ordered:
- Stray dogs must be removed from specified public premises – schools, colleges, hospitals, bus stands, railway stations, and sports complexes.
- They should be shifted to designated shelters.
- Removal must follow mandatory sterilisation and vaccination protocols laid down in the ABC Rules, 2023.
- The order aims to ensure public safety, especially in high-footfall areas, while ensuring humane treatment of animals.
What Are the ABC Rules, 2023?
- The Animal Birth Control (ABC) Rules, 2023, notified under the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als Act, 1960, regulate stray dog population control through sterilisation and immunization, not culling.
- ABC Rules mandate local bodies to establish dog sterilisation centres, maintain proper facilities, and carry out humane capture, neutering, vaccination, and release of dogs.

Implications of the Supreme Court’s Order and the ABC Rules:
The Supreme Court’s order, coupled with the ABC Rules, has several significant implications:
- Enhanced Public Safety: Removing stray dogs from sensitive public areas like schools and hospitals aims to reduce the risk of dog bites and potential disease transmission.
- Humane Animal Management: The emphasis on sterilization and vaccination ensures a more humane approach to managing stray dog populations compared to culling or relocation without proper care.
- Community Involvement: The ABC Rules encourage community participation in the care and welfare of community animals, fostering a sense of shared responsibility.
- Legal Framework: The Rules provide a legal framework for addressing issues related to stray dogs, ensuring consistency and accountability in their management.
- Resource Allocation: Effective implementation of the ABC Rules requires adequate resources for sterilization programs, vaccination campaigns, shelter maintenance, and community awareness initiatives.
By prioritizing sterilization, vaccination, and community involvement, these measures aim to balance public safety with the welfare of community animals. Successful implementation requires collaboration between government agencies, animal welfare organizations, and the community at large.
